Parashas Eikev · Passuk 11:21
to the end that you and your children may endure, in the land that GOD swore to your fathersifathers See note at 1.35. to assign to them, as long as there is a heaven over the earth.
Torah Temimah points to Bava Batra 2b.
TT lemma: וימי בניכם (unit 5 of 9).
English: I might have thought “your children” excludes daughters; therefore it says “in order that they be multiplied” — a blessing, and one who blesses does so with a generous eye. Elsewhere “sons” may exclude daughters; here the language of increase opens the blessing widely.
